Alert: BackfillHerder missed-run detection. Fires when the nightly scheduler fails to launch one or more backfill jobs by 03:30. Common causes are a stuck lock from the previous night's run or an exhausted worker pool in the Duskline cluster. Do not manually re-trigger jobs without first releasing the lock, or you'll get duplicate partitions. Severity is low unless two consecutive nights are missed. Full remediation steps for future maintainers are here:

operations page: https://confluence.qorvellabs.internal/projects/projects/projects/pages/a358

// Image cache for the Thornquist render pipeline.
// Plugin authors: the leak you may have heard about came from decoded
// bitmaps being pinned by stale preview handles, so entries never aged
// out. The cache now enforces a hard byte ceiling and evicts by
// last-access time. If your plugin holds references past a frame,
// release them explicitly or the evictor will skip those entries and
// memory will climb again. Eviction cadence and size limits are the
// constants defined below.

constants for tageg-kagag:
QUOTAS = {
    "kelax": 495,
    "istath": 366,
    "tammir": 108,
    "novdor": 730,
    "casax": 816,
    "quenael": 874,
    "pelius": 403,
}

The matchmaker-svc account runs the Pairwise matching service under heavy allocation churn, and recent GC pauses (up to 900ms) traced back to its oversized token cache. We've trimmed the cache and moved the account to the low-latency pool. For the sync: no action needed except updating local test harnesses, which should authenticate against the Pairwise staging API using the key below.

app token of kajop-tahag = qvz23-qaEp6MzrfP2AwhVbZwsZeUq

## Capacity note: autocomplete index (Findlet)

New folks: the autocomplete index rebuilds nightly and it's slow by design. Full rebuild walks ~40M terms; incremental merges run hourly and absorb most churn. The pain point is p99 lookup latency during merge windows, when segment count spikes. Do not shrink the merge interval to chase freshness — it trades a minor staleness win for a major latency regression, and we've been burned twice. Headroom today is roughly 2x projected growth through next year. Current tuning values are below.

limits module of fajog-tawig:
RATE_LIMITS = {
    "druwyn": 2,
    "quenael": 10,
    "wenix": 2,
    "druael": 2,
}